对数的换底公式是怎么推导出来的-对数换底公式推导
想象一下,我们手里拿着一个计算器,它只认底数为 e 的自然对数,记作 $ln x$。但现实生活中,我们天天用的 $log_{10} 2$ 要么 $log_2 3$,往往更直观。
这时候,我们就得从“换装备”的角度看难题。换底公式实际上就是个数学上的换算工具,它告诉你如何把一个底换到新的底,与此同时保证数值不变。 这背后的逻辑实际上挺好办,就是利用指数对数的互逆关系。我们在内存里存的是 $y = log_b x$ 这种形式,但处理器喜爱处理 $e^{y ln x}$ 这种形式。
要是我们要让一个计算器能直接算出 $log_a x$,它就得知道 $y = log_a x$ 等于多少个 $ln x$。
要么反过来想,要是已知 $y = ln x$,它要算出 $log_a x$,得把底数从 $e$ 换到 $a$。
这就好比你在物理课上换算速度单位,从米每秒换成千米每小时,别看数字变了,但物理意义没变。 推导的核心就藏在那个底数的指数里。我们要算 $y = log_a x$。根据对数定义,这意味着 $a^y = x$,也就是 $y = log_a x = frac{ln x}{ln a}$。
这里 $ln x$ 是底数 $e$ 的对数,保持不变;而那个分母里的 $ln a$,就是我们要做的“换底”。出于 $ln a = log_e a$,故此公式里整个 $a$ 的底都变成了 $e$。 为了把这个抽象的公式变得不那么枯燥,咱们得找个具体的例子。假设我们要算 $log_{10} 100$,也就是常用对数。直接看底数是 10,仿佛有点绕。我们试着用换底公式来算。分母是 $ln 10$,分子是 $ln 100$。$ln 100$ 等于 $2ln 10$。
这就把 $100$ 拆开了,变成了两个 $ln 10$。一除一除,$2ln 10 / ln 10$ 剩下一个 2。 这个过程有点像在解方程。我们设 $y = log_{10} 100$。两边取自然对数,就是 $ln y = ln(log_{10} 100)$。
这时候要是直接算 $ln(log_{10} 100)$ 肯定数值忒复杂,我们换个思路。用换底公式把右边的 $log_{10}$ 换成 $ln$。
那就是 $ln y = frac{ln(ln 100)}{ln 10}$。别看右边变复杂了,但左边还是那个熟悉的 $y$。
要是我们进一步对两边取对数,那就变成了 $ln y = frac{ln(ln 100)}{ln 10}$,这时候要是我们假设 $y=2$,左边是 $ln 2$,右边呢?$frac{ln(ln 100)}{ln 10} = frac{ln(2ln 10)}{ln 10}$ 这个式子看起来乱套了,实际上我们不需求算出右边的具体值,只要知道 $2 = frac{ln 100}{ln 10}$ 这个事实就够了。 再举个例子,算 $log_2 8$。
这题忒经典了,8 是 2 的三次方,故此答案肯定是 3。用换底公式推导:$y = log_2 8$,换底后变成 $y = frac{ln 8}{ln 2}$。$ln 8$ 是 $ln(2^3)$,根据对数性质能够展开成 $3ln 2$。便式子就变成了 $frac{3ln 2}{ln 2}$。分子分母里的 $ln 2$ 消掉了,剩下 3。
这就神奇了,原本复杂的底数 2 消亡了,直接显露出结局。 这种推导方式之故此有效,是出于它利用了同一底数的对数具有“伸缩性”的特性。就像把一根橡皮筋拉长要么压缩,长度变了,但弹性系数没变。$log_a x$ 和 $log_e x$ 之间只差一个系数 $frac{1}{ln a}$。
要是你把 $log_a x$ 的分子分母都换成 $ln$,整个表达式就乘以了这个系数。 在实际计算中,这种方式有时候能带来意外的益处。
比如在某些工程计算要么编程中,你不需求每次都纠结底数是 2 还是 10,统一用 $ln$ 和 $pi$ 去计算可能会让精度更可控,要么在处理对数链式运算时能削减阶乘的形式。自然,最实用的地方还是在计算器上,当你把科学模式切换成常用对数要么自然对数时,实际上不同底数的计算器底层代码可能只是在单纯地做指数运算,背后那个“换底”的过程已经自动搞定了。 自然,公式也能够从纯代数角度反向思索。我们知道 $log_{a} x = frac{1}{log_{x} a}$。
要是你把分母里的底数从 $x$ 换成 $e$,分子上的 $a$ 也要跟着换底。
这样就自然导出了 $log_{a} x = frac{ln x}{ln a}$。
这说明甭管是从定义出发,还是从倒数关系出发,逻辑都是一环扣一环的。 最终再总结一下,这个公式的本质就是统一度量衡。它把不同底数的对数强行拉回到了同一个坐标系里,让我们能够自由穿梭。
只要记住分子是 $ln x$,分母是 $ln a$,任何底数的对数都能瞬间变成自然对数。
这就是数学赋予我们的强大工具,它让原本陌生的数字变得可计算、可理解。
声明:演示网站所有内容,若无特殊说明或标注,均来源于网络转载,仅供学习交流使用,禁止商用。若本站侵犯了你的权益,可联系本站删除。
